A tasting of Ridge's Rhone style and Zinfandel wines. Meaning we skipped the Bordeaux styled wines. We had dinner at Aureole in NYC, and I thought it would be fun to have these wines with their Cheeseburger. We had a white wine starter from WA state, followed by 5 red Ridge wines.
I think all the wines went very well with the cheeseburger and fries. But the group favorite was the 2017 Geyserville. As for 2nd favorite and least favorite, there was no universal agreement among the 10 of us.
